    This critically-explorative series presents watershed moments in American history. Students learn how the courage, ideas, and innovations of historic Americans combined with dynamic political, economic, and cultural forces to change or guide the course of America's destiny. From the Declaration of Independence to the Gold Rush and beyond, students see how history is made, and are invited to consider how the United States became the country that it is today. Interesting sidebars and graphic organizers create another layer of enriched learning, making these books a favorite source for students.
